Hello, I'm switching parts form a non-title 1980 KZ1000 LTD Frame to a titled 1979 LTD KZ1000 frame. Everything was going great until I came to the upper right rear motor mount. The right side motor mount and side cover mount didn't come with the 79 frame. I figured both years were the same but it is apparently not.

The lower right side cover mount and the cross bar that the battery box mounts to are different as well as the way the master cylinder mounts to the frame. I'm having trouble attaching pictures so I and can email them to you if needed. The 80 frame has a bolt on a pad to mount the lower right side cover grommet and the 79 does not. I researched on BuyKawaski and Thrifty Rider parts diagrams and it didn't show the details of the mount.

So what was the problem or difference between the 79 and 80 LTD models........ The 1980 model switched over to the new style Master Cylinder with the remote reservoir and the 79 had the single piece unit.. Also with this change came with a total rework of the right side motor mount, cross member and lower side cover grommet holder. I was fortunate to have a one piece Master Cylinder laying around and searching through my 100 pounds of miscellaneous parts box I came across the proper grommet holder. The 79 right side motor mount bracket was miraculously still at the dealer for about 15 bucks. All is good now with no more head scratching. The engine will be in the frame tomorrow.
